You can have My Family's Meatball Recipe using 8 ingredients and 7 steps. Here is how you achieve it.
Ingredients of My Family's Meatball Recipe
- You need 500 grams of Ground meat (I used ground beef, but use whatever works).
- It’s 50 grams of Onion.
- It’s 40 grams of Panko (homemade).
- It’s 1 of Egg (large).
- You need 1/2 of teaspon Japanese Worcestershire-style sauce.
- It’s 3/4 tsp of Salt.
- Prepare 1 pinch of Black pepper.
- You need 1 dash of Nutmeg.

My Family's Meatball Recipe instructions
Preheat the oven to 190℃. Finely chop the onion. Beat the egg..
Put all the ingredients in a bowl and mix well. Shape the mixture into balls to whatever size you prefer. Line the meatballs on a baking pan. Bake in the oven for about 10 minutes and it's done..
